This shale inhibitor is a dry powder blend containing silicic acid and potassium salts. It is used in water-based drilling fluids to inhibit and stabilize active clays, seal pore spaces and microfractures in formations, reduce mud-out risks, minimize solid phase accumulation, and mitigate corrosion. Suitable for freshwater and monovalent salt systems, it exhibits temperature resistance up to 160°C. This product is incompatible with divalent ions; therefore, seawater hardness must be reduced when preparing drilling fluids with seawater.
| Type | Shale Inhibitors |
| Recommended Dosage | 10-20 kg/m³ |
| Appearance | White powder |
| Specific Gravity | 0.76 |
| pH | 12 (1% aqueous solution) |
| Packaging | 25 kg/bag |
